Raspberry pi 2 安装GTK
2016-01-13 23:34
1581 查看
apt-get install pkg-config #用于在编译GTK程序时自动找出头文件及库文件位置
apt-get install devhelp #这将安装 devhelp GTK文档查看程序
apt-get install libglib2.0-doc libgtk2.0-doc #这将安装 gtk/glib 的API参考手册及其它帮助文档
apt-get install glade libglade2-dev #这将安装基于GTK的界面GTK是开发Gnome窗口的c/c++语言图
pkg-config –version #查看GTK版本
pkg-config –list-all | grep gtk #查看是否安装GTK
gtk+-2.0 GTK+ - GTK+ Graphical UI Library (x11 target)
lxappearance lxappearance - Tool used to customize look and feel of gtk+ applications.
gtk+-unix-print-2.0 GTK+ - GTK+ Unix print support
gtk+-x11-2.0 GTK+ - GTK+ Graphical UI Library (x11 target)
pkg-config –cflags –libs gtk+-2.0 #查看GTK路径
-pthread -I/usr/include/gtk-2.0 -I/usr/lib/arm-linux-gnueabihf/gtk-2.0/include -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/gdk-pixbuf-2.0 -I/usr/include/pango-1.0 -I/usr/include/gio-unix-2.0/ -I/usr/include/glib-2.0 -I/usr/lib/arm-linux-gnueabihf/glib-2.0/include -I/usr/include/pixman-1 -I/usr/include/freetype2 -I/usr/include/libpng12 -I/usr/include/harfbuzz -lgtk-x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lgio-2.0 -lpangoft2-1.0 -lpangocairo-1.0 -lgdk_pixbuf-2.0 -lcairo -lpango-1.0 -lfreetype -lfontconfig -lgobject-2.0 -lglib-2.0
gcc -o helloworld helloworld.c
apt-get install devhelp #这将安装 devhelp GTK文档查看程序
apt-get install libglib2.0-doc libgtk2.0-doc #这将安装 gtk/glib 的API参考手册及其它帮助文档
apt-get install glade libglade2-dev #这将安装基于GTK的界面GTK是开发Gnome窗口的c/c++语言图
pkg-config –version #查看GTK版本
pkg-config –list-all | grep gtk #查看是否安装GTK
gtk+-2.0 GTK+ - GTK+ Graphical UI Library (x11 target)
lxappearance lxappearance - Tool used to customize look and feel of gtk+ applications.
gtk+-unix-print-2.0 GTK+ - GTK+ Unix print support
gtk+-x11-2.0 GTK+ - GTK+ Graphical UI Library (x11 target)
pkg-config –cflags –libs gtk+-2.0 #查看GTK路径
-pthread -I/usr/include/gtk-2.0 -I/usr/lib/arm-linux-gnueabihf/gtk-2.0/include -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/gdk-pixbuf-2.0 -I/usr/include/pango-1.0 -I/usr/include/gio-unix-2.0/ -I/usr/include/glib-2.0 -I/usr/lib/arm-linux-gnueabihf/glib-2.0/include -I/usr/include/pixman-1 -I/usr/include/freetype2 -I/usr/include/libpng12 -I/usr/include/harfbuzz -lgtk-x11-2.0 -lgdk-x11-2.0 -latk-1.0 -lgio-2.0 -lpangoft2-1.0 -lpangocairo-1.0 -lgdk_pixbuf-2.0 -lcairo -lpango-1.0 -lfreetype -lfontconfig -lgobject-2.0 -lglib-2.0
gcc -o helloworld helloworld.c
pkg-config --cflags --libs gtk+-2.0#编译 注意库是用反单引号括起来的,反单引号在ESC下面那个按键
相关文章推荐
- 修复mysql数据库
- nodejs中的fiber(纤程)库详解
- 桌面中心(一)创建数据库
- 浅析C语言头文件和库的一些问题
- Centos搭建GTK+Codeblock完整版
- 桌面中心(三)修改数据库
- 目前流行的JavaScript库的介绍及对比
- MySql表、字段、库的字符集修改及查看方法
- 11个并不被常用但对开发非常有帮助的Python库
- Python标准库与第三方库详解
- linux下的图形界面扫雷游戏(Gtk+2.0)
- 实验九 模板与库使用
- gdk模拟鼠标按键事件/焦点事件
- GTK常规问题解答
- 【cocostudio】如何解决2.0版本打不开的问题
- 构建 C++ 开发环境包括 gtk、qt 等开发库
- PHP+Gtk实例(求24点)
- GtkMessageDialog
- centos6.2运行ibm install manager 报错libswt-pi-gtk-4234.so
- 【转】:C++ 库